Chess Puzzle #D0AJe — Advanced, Black to move, endgame

Rating 1684 · Advanced · defensive move, endgame, equality, short.

Position

White: king h1; rooks d8/f1; bishop e7; pawns g2/h3. Black: king c6; queen c2; pawns a7/c4/f7/g5. White is ahead by 2 points of material. Black to move.

Solution (2 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: Rc8+ — rook d8→c8, gives check. Now Black to move.
  2. Best move: Kd7 — king c6→d7. Opponent replies Ra8 (rook c8→a8).
  3. Best move: Kxe7 — king d7→e7, captures bishop.

Tactical themes

defensive move, endgame, equality, short. The key move is Kd7.

Position data

FEN: 3R4/p3Bp2/2k5/6p1/2p5/7P/2q3P1/5R1K w - - 0 31
